This study aimed to examine the effect of the Problem-Based Learning (PBL) model with a Deep Learning approach on the creative thinking skills of fourth-grade students at SD Negeri Banyubiru 1 Magelang in learning the perimeter and area of plane figures. This research employed a quantitative method with an experimental design. The participants consisted of 20 students from Class IV A of SD Negeri Banyubiru 1. Data were collected through tests and observations. The research instruments included pre-test and post-test questions on creative thinking skills and observation sheets. The assessed aspects of creative thinking were fluency, flexibility, originality, and elaboration. Data were analyzed using normality, homogeneity, linearity, and hypothesis testing (t-test) with the assistance of SPSS software.The findings showed that the significance value (Sig. 2-tailed) was 0.000, which was lower than the significance level of 0.05. Therefore, the alternative hypothesis (Ha) was accepted, while the null hypothesis (H₀) was rejected. These results indicate that the Problem-Based Learning model with a Deep Learning approach had a significant effect on students’ creative thinking skills. Following the implementation of the learning model, students demonstrated improvements in generating ideas, proposing various alternative answers, finding diverse solutions, and elaborating their ideas in greater detail. Thus, the Problem-Based Learning model with a Deep Learning approach had a positive and significant effect on students’ creative thinking skills in mathematics learning at SD Negeri Banyubiru 1.
